Background technique
It is well known that (such as crawler-mounted excavator, crawler crane, crawler drill are even for track-type work equipment
Military tanks etc.) it is not have dynamic during production and assembly, as job that requires special skills equipment, itself heavier (up to more than 30
Ton even tons up to a hundred) without power, it is difficult to carry out flowing water assembling work as automobile assembly line during assembling operation,
It can only be transmitted on rail motor-driven running water line flatcar, or be carried using bridge crane.Such work pattern,
Shortcoming is embodied in: 1, the use needs of rail motor-driven running water line flatcar are laid with track, car body position quilt on the ground in advance
Track limit, car body can only forward-reverse in orbit, cannot turn, is inflexible, and is inconvenient for use, at high cost;Car body turns
Curved to need to carry out by track, turning radius is big, occupies the working space of larger space;2, overhead traveling crane (bridge crane) is conveying
In the process, it needs finished product or semi-finished product to promote certain altitude, suspention carries out carrying transport in the sky.Certainly because of finished product or semi-finished product
Body is heavier, and hanging transporting hasardous is high, in transportational process because move in parallel acceleration or deceleration, start and stop and lead to product
It reverses and swings, transmit extremely unstable;And be also possible to fall in the transmission or hit, the quality of product is damaged or damaged
It loses.Therefore more stable and safe ground when we need a using flexible, are not take up hall space, are low in cost, transporting
Transport transfer car(buggy) in face.
